There are 5 types of feet: each indicating a particular personality type

Morphopsychology is based on the principle of studying the shape of the body and face, in order to reveal character traits that are often buried and unconscious. The general build is thus scanned psychologically, without forgetting the other physical parts of the body such as the hands or the feet, which in turn indicate characteristic aspects of the personality.

It turns out that reading the shape of the feet can reveal traits inherent to the personality. This precise analysis of the toes and based on their alignment, could give an insight into our behaviors and our ways of thinking and living. Egyptian foot

This foot is characterized by a symmetry of the toes; the big toe being longer than the others. Those who have the shape of Egyptian feet are considered to have a sovereign temperament, and often remain sociable and balanced.

Very focused on culture and discovery, they are on the lookout for new experiences, most frequently acquired during their many travels. In addition, their ability to listen and understand gives them the quality of being empathetic, aware of the emotional source of others;

they do not judge, avoid conflicts and seek to establish peace in their path. Suffice to say that they embody compassion which unfortunately, is often seen as a weakness. Some may even regret living with this quality which only generates suffering in their life.
